
Scottish Enterprise is Scotland's main economic development agency and a non-departmental public body of the Scottish Government. Scottish Enterprise aim to improve and build Scotland's international competitiveness by focusing on the following areas which they consider to be critical for growth:
Encouraging international trade and investment to build on Scotland's global reputation.
Scottish Enterprise support ambitious Scottish companies to develop their international strategy, offering:
